slots

package
v5.0.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jan 21, 2023 License: Unlicense Imports: 6 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type DateSettingsDateSettingsSpecificDay

type DateSettingsDateSettingsSpecificDay struct {
	ID      string `json:"row_id"`
	Date    string `json:"date"`
	AltDate string `json:"alt_date"`
}

type HolidaysHolidaysHoliday

type HolidaysHolidaysHoliday struct {
	Date      string `json:"date"`
	AltDate   string `json:"alt_date"`
	DateTo    string `json:"date_to"`
	AltDateTo string `json:"alt_date_to"`
}

type Slots

type Slots struct {
	DateSettingsDateSettingsSpecificDays []DateSettingsDateSettingsSpecificDay `json:"datesettings_datesettings_specific_days"`
	DateSettingsDateSettingsMinimum      string                                `json:"datesettings_datesettings_minimum"`
	DateSettingsDateSettingsMaximum      string                                `json:"datesettings_datesettings_maximum"`
	TimeSettingsTimeSettingsTimeSlots    []TimeSettingsTimeSettingsTimeSlot    `json:"timesettings_timesettings_timeslots"`
	TimeSettingsTimeSettingsCutoff       string                                `json:"timesettings_timesettings_cutoff"`
	HolidaysHolidaysHolidays             []HolidaysHolidaysHoliday             `json:"holidays_holidays_holidays"`
}

func GetSlots

func GetSlots(ctx context.Context) (*Slots, error)

type TimeSettingsTimeSettingsTimeSlot

type TimeSettingsTimeSettingsTimeSlot struct {
	Duration  string   `json:"duration"`
	Frequency string   `json:"frequency"`
	TimeFrom  string   `json:"timefrom"`
	TimeTo    string   `json:"timeto"`
	Days      []string `json:"days"`
}

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L